Skibidi Toilet is an animated YouTube series created by Alexey Gerasimov, also known as “Boom!” The series features the ...
Devil May Cry is a series of hack-and-slash video games featuring a slew of characters with half and quarter demon heritage who use their demonic powers and human determination to fight against forces ...